What is NEPA?
Established on January 1, 1970, the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A) plays a crucial role in safeguarding both natural and built environments. It mandates that federal agencies carefully evaluate how proposed actions may affect the long-term preservation and sustainability of natural and cultural resources, ecosystems, and biodiversity.

The ERIS NEPA Report provides the assessment of various important aspects related to environmental impact analysis. It includes information on:

Sensitive Receptors

1. FCC and FAA Sites (Communications Towers):

• AM Radio Structures

• Antenna Structure Registration

• Cellular Towers

2. Historic Sites Report:

• Cemetery Features

• National Register of Historic Places

• AIAN Land Area Representations

• Indian Reservations

• Tribal Leaders Directory

3. Natural Areas Report:

• Approved Acquisition Boundaries

• Coastal Barrier Resource System

• National Natural Landmark Sites

• National Wild and Scenic Rivers System

• National Wildlife Refuge System

4. Sensitive Receptors:

• Hospital Facilities

• NCES Postsecondary Schools

• NCES Private Schools

• NCES Public Schools

• Nursing Homes

• Places of Worship

5. Special Status Species Report:

• Critical Habitats*
(*Federal Critical Habitats, including Threatened and Endangered Species data for the entire US (not State-level species data outside Texas) )

6. FEMA Maps:

• FEMA National Flood Hazard Layer

7. Wetlands (NWI) Map:

• U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service Wetland Data

Texas-Specific Special Status Species Report: Texas-Specific Special Status Species Report: If your project is in Texas, our special report provides information on critical habitats, rare, threatened, and endangered species, Texas Natural Diversity Database element occurrences, and wildlife-managed areas.
